feat(website): Add Privacy Policy link to top navigation bar#1227
feat(website): Add Privacy Policy link to top navigation bar#1227
Conversation
Add Privacy Policy as a top-level navigation item across all 15 language configurations, linking to each locale's existing privacy policy page. https://claude.ai/code/session_01JqMS8rRE7ZBWagNcHEwTVj
|
No actionable comments were generated in the recent review. 🎉 ℹ️ Recent review info⚙️ Run configurationConfiguration used: Path: .coderabbit.yaml Review profile: CHILL Plan: Pro Run ID: 📒 Files selected for processing (15)
📝 WalkthroughWalkthroughAdds privacy policy navigation links across 15 language-specific VitePress configuration files. Each configuration file receives one new navigation entry with the appropriate language translation, linking to Changes
Estimated code review effort🎯 1 (Trivial) | ⏱️ ~3 minutes Possibly related PRs
🚥 Pre-merge checks | ✅ 2 | ❌ 1❌ Failed checks (1 inconclusive)
✅ Passed checks (2 passed)
✏️ Tip: You can configure your own custom pre-merge checks in the settings. ✨ Finishing Touches
🧪 Generate unit tests (beta)
📝 Coding Plan
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ment Tip You can make CodeRabbit's review stricter and more nitpicky using the `assertive` profile, if that's what you prefer.Change the |
Summary of ChangesHello, I'm Gemini Code Assist1! I'm currently reviewing this pull request and will post my feedback shortly. In the meantime, here's a summary to help you and other reviewers quickly get up to speed! This pull request significantly improves the website's user experience and legal compliance by integrating a readily accessible Privacy Policy link into the top navigation bar. This change is consistently applied across all supported language versions, ensuring that privacy information is easily found by users regardless of their preferred language. Highlights
🧠 New Feature in Public Preview: You can now enable Memory to help Gemini Code Assist learn from your team's feedback. This makes future code reviews more consistent and personalized to your project's style. Click here to enable Memory in your admin console. Changelog
Activity
Using Gemini Code AssistThe full guide for Gemini Code Assist can be found on our documentation page, here are some quick tips. Invoking Gemini You can request assistance from Gemini at any point by creating a comment using either
Customization To customize Gemini Code Assist for GitHub experience, repository maintainers can create a configuration file and/or provide a custom code review style guide (such as PEP-8 for Python) by creating and adding files to a Limitations & Feedback Gemini Code Assist may make mistakes. Please leave feedback on any instances where its feedback is incorrect or counter productive. You can react with 👍 and 👎 on @gemini-code-assist comments. If you're interested in giving your feedback about your experience with Gemini Code Assist for GitHub and other Google products, sign up here. You can also get AI-powered code generation, chat, as well as code reviews directly in the IDE at no cost with the Gemini Code Assist IDE Extension. Footnotes
|
There was a problem hiding this comment.
Code Review
This pull request adds a 'Privacy Policy' link to the main navigation bar across all supported languages (German, English, Spanish, French, Hindi, Indonesian, Italian, Japanese, Korean, Brazilian Portuguese, Russian, Turkish, Vietnamese, Simplified Chinese, and Traditional Chinese) by updating their respective VitePress configuration files.
PR Review: feat(website): Add Privacy Policy link to top navigation barOverall AssessmentThis is a clean, straightforward PR that adds a Privacy Policy link to the top navigation bar across all 15 locale configurations. The implementation is consistent and all referenced privacy pages exist. Verdict: Looks good with one design consideration worth discussing. Positive Aspects
Design Consideration: Nav Bar vs Footer PlacementDetailsThe Privacy Policy link is added as a top-level nav item, making the nav bar go from 3 to 4 items:
While 4 items is still reasonable, a privacy policy link is conventionally placed in the footer rather than the top navigation. The shared config ( footer: {
message: 'Released under the MIT License.',
copyright: 'Copyright © 2024 Kazuki Yamada',
}Suggestion: Consider whether the footer would be a more conventional location for this link. If placed in the footer's This is a UX/design decision, not a code quality issue — either approach works. Just flagging for the maintainer's consideration. Premortem: Potential Failure Scenarios
SummaryNo blocking issues. The PR is clean, consistent across all locales, and links are verified. The only point for discussion is whether the top nav or footer is the preferred placement — that's a product decision for the maintainer. 🤖 Generated with Claude Code |
Codecov Report✅ All modified and coverable lines are covered by tests. Additional details and impacted files@@ Coverage Diff @@
## main #1227 +/- ##
=======================================
Coverage 87.14% 87.14%
=======================================
Files 115 115
Lines 4310 4310
Branches 998 998
=======================================
Hits 3756 3756
Misses 554 554 ☔ View full report in Codecov by Sentry. 🚀 New features to boost your workflow:
|
Add Privacy Policy as a top-level navigation item across all 15 language
configurations, linking to each locale's existing privacy policy page.
https://claude.ai/code/session_01JqMS8rRE7ZBWagNcHEwTVj